Mr. Peter Johnson aged twenty-three battled for half an hour to escape from his trapped car yesterday when it landed upside down in three feet of water. He took the only escape route—through the boot.
Mr. Johnson’s car had ended up in a ditch at Romney Marsin Kent after he lost proper control on ice and hit a bank. “Fortunately the water began to come in only slowly ” Mr. Johnson said. “I couldn’t force the doors open because they were jammed against the walls of the ditch and dared not open the windows because I knew water would come flooding in.”
Mr. Johnson a sweet salesman of Sitting Home Kent first tried to attract the attention of other motorists by sounding the horn and hammering on the roof and boot. Then he began his struggle to escape. [来源:学.科.网]
Later he said “It was really a half penny that saved my life. It was the only coin I had in my pocket and I used it to unscrew the back seat to get into the boot. I hammered desperately with a hammer trying to make someone hear but no help came.”
It took ten minutes to unscrew the seat and a further five minutes to clear the sweet samples from the boot. Then Mr. Johnson found a wrench (扳手) and began to work on the boot lock. Fifteen minutes passed by. “It was the only chance I had. Finally it gave but as soon as I moved the boot lid the water and mud poured in. I forced the lid down into the mud and climbed up clear as the car filled up.”
His hands and arms cut and bruised Mr. Johnson got to Beckett Farm nearby. Huddled in a blanket he said “That thirty minutes seemed like hours.” Only the tips of the car wheels were visible police said last night. The vehicle had sunk into two feet of mud at the bottom of the ditch.
